Ok, it looks a _lot_ better, but I have a few minor nits, and one larger
one:

- rename the vmbus_child_* functions to vmbus_* as there's no need to
  think of "children" here.

- vmbus_onoffer comment is incorrect.  You handle offers from lots of
  other types.  Or if not, am I reading the code incorrectly?

- the static hv_cb_utils array needs to go away.  In the hv_utils.c
  util_probe() call, properly register the channel callback, and the
  same goes for the util_remove() call, unregister things there.
  Note, you can use the driver_data field to determine exactly which
  callback needs to be registered to make things easy.  Something like
  the following (pseudo code only):

static const struct hv_vmbus_device_id id_table[] = {
        /* Shutdown guid */
        { VMBUS_DEVICE(0x31, 0x60, 0x0B, 0X0E, 0x13, 0x52, 0x34, 0x49,
                       0x81, 0x8B, 0x38, 0XD9, 0x0C, 0xED, 0x39, 0xDB),
          .driver_data = &shutdown_onchannelcallback },
        ....
};

util_probe(struct hv_device *dev, const struct hv_vmbus_device_id *id)
 [ Yes, you will have to change the probe callback signature, but that's fine. ]
{
        void *fn(void *context);
        u8 *buffer;

        fn = id->driver_data;
        buffer = kmalloc(PAGE_SIZE, GFP_KERNEL);

        /* Hook up callback and buffer with a call to the proper vmbus
         * function
         */
         ...
}

util_remove()
{
        /* undo what you did in util_probe(), unhooking the callback and
         * freeing the data */
}


Does that make any sense?
